From the Inside Flap:
Perilous Passage is an account of Wilson's apprenticeship under the tutelage of the master shamanic practitioner, Brion Gysin, and focuses on events as they developed just prior to and after Gysin's death. This book details the extreme psychic "Third Mind" effects known as the Process. Wilson describes his mentor as resolutely refusing to "teach," without ever ceasing to do so. "Brion did not confront people bluntly. The effect of his lessons, conversely, could be brutally blunt. Sink-or-swim blunt." Perilous Passage finalizes Wilson's 'Green Base Trilogy' which commenced with Dreams of Green Base and 'D' Train. His other book, Here to Go, is a classic book of interviews with Brion Gysin documenting the life, work and philosophy of this brilliant avant-garde figure.
